New publication of Schubert's Ave Maria for String Duo as well as for string-quartet

Titelblatt_vln_und_va_version Cover_AveMaria_quartett

Print edition of: the famous "Ave Maria" (Ellens Gesang III, op. 52,6, D 839) by Franz Schubert

Transcribed for violin viola duo and String quartet by Christoph Emmanuel LANGHEIM

Revised by the String-Duo Halaf-Langheim

Reviews:

Archi Magazine - maggio-giugno 2011
... Questo adattamento dell’Ave Maria per quartetto d’archi, ad opera di Christoph Emmanuel Langheim, intende rimanere fedele il più possibile all’originale, assegnando la parte del canto al Violino I, mentre il Violino II e la Viola eseguono le terzine con il pizzicato ed il Violoncello, sempre pizzicando, completa l’armonia eseguendo crome in battere, intervallate da pause dello stesso valore ... Da segnalare che, sempre a cura di Langheim, Ut Orpheus ha pubblicato anche la versione per violino e viola. (Pamela Gargiuto)

Strings Magazine (November 2011)
... Due to its devoutly religious nature, the song is often used in sacred ceremonies (with the Latin liturgical text). This arrangement may be useful for occasions where no piano is available. The music is printed in large, clear type and carries bar numbers. The preface, in German and English, includes Schubert's own comments on the song and the text of all three verses. (Edith Eisler)

Just published: 12 jewish Songs for violin and viola duo

News - Articles


12 Jewish Songs: score and parts

For violin an viola composed by Riccardo Joshua Moretti

arranged for violin and viola by Emilio GHEZZI and Christoph Emmanuel LANGHEIM

Revised by String-Duo Halaf-Langheim

Includes the following titles:

“Ebraica”, “La Notte della shoà”, “Solo”, “Kadish”, “Lemek”, “Ninnananna” (Arranged by E.Ghezzi)

“Shir”, “Eretz”, “Yr Shalom”, “Halom”, "Golà”, “Mitzvà" (Arranged by Christoph E. Langheim)

Publisher: Ut Orpheus Edizioni

String duo performed Mozart's Sinfonia Concertante in Magenta (Italy)

January 16, 2010 at 21h

Magenta (Italy), Teatro Lirico di Magenta

String-Duo Halaf-Langheim performed as soloists the

“Sinfonia Concertante” KV364 (320d)in E-flat major by W.A.Mozart with the ORCHESTRA CITTA' DI MAGENTA under the baton of:

Alberto MALAZZI (co-choir conductor at the La Scala Orchestra in Milano)

RECENSIONE ALL’ANNUNZIATA

L’affiatato String Duo inaugura con sapienza «Chiostro d’estate»

E’ stato il suono morbido e raffinato del violino e della viola ad inaugurare sabato, nella cornice del chiostro della chiesa dell’Annunziata, la sesta edizione di Chiostro d’Estate, la rassegna concertistica organizzata da Parma OperArt e Associazione Amici di Padre Lino col patrocinio del Comune di Parma e la collaborazione del Convento dell’Annunziata.

Protagonista dell’incontro è stato infatti lo String Duo formato da Hagit Halaf e Christoph Langheim, rispettivamente violino e viola, formazione sorta poco meno di dieci anni fa e che, costituita da due musicisti dall’intensa attività solistica, da camera o in eminenti compagini orchestrali, ha presentato un programma di grande piacevolezza che andava dal barocco haendeliano ai tanghi di Piazzolla passando per Rossini, Schubert, Pacini, Paganini, con una puntata alla musica d’oggi, benché imbevuta della lunga storica tradizione ebraica, con una composizione di Moretti. Programma eclettico e particolarmente impegnativo, per le caratteristiche intrinseche date dall’unione di questi due strumenti eminentemente monodici, le caratteristiche stilistiche delle pagine successivamente presentate, e quelle virtuosistiche di quasi tutte le trascrizioni (d’epoca o moderne, alcune dello stesso Langheim) nelle quali le varie pagine erano state riviste, a cominciare proprio dalla celeberrima Passacaglia di Händel da Johan Halvorsen, per non parlare poi di quelle, già votate dalla nascita a questa peculiarità, come Il Carnevale di Venezia nella versione di Paganini, o la Sinfonia rossiniana dal Barbiere di Siviglia, le arie operistiche di Pacini o ancora Rossini, per citarne solo alcune. Le pagine più moderne aggiungevano ulteriori sfaccettature a questa ricca proposta, offerta con grande proprietà stilistica e saldezza tecnica da due musicisti a loro agio nel risolvere con disinvolta musicalità le difficoltà di queste pagine, in un risultato salutato dal pubblico con molti convinti applausi, e ripagato… a suon di musica.♦ v.r.s.

Halaf, Langheim to perform 2 shows

Apr. 20, 2009
MAXIM REIDER , THE JERUSALEM POST

Hagit Halaf and Christoph Emmanuel Langheim - a violin/viola duo and a couple - will appear as soloists in Mozart's Sinfonia Concertante with the Ramat Gan Chamber Orchestra under Aviv RON on April 23 in Bat Yam (03-508-0031) and April 25 in Ramat Gan (03-578-1688).
